Distinguish between the terms homopolymer and copolymer and give an example of each.

The Classification homopolymer and copolymer is based on the number of different types of monomer units present in a polymer. In other words homopolymer and copolymer differ whether only one type of monomer unit is present or more than one type of monomer units are present.

There are different ways in which polymers are classified. One classification is based on the number of different types of monomer units present in a polymer. On this basis, the polymers can be classified into homopolymer and copolymer.

HomopolymerCopolymer
Homopolymer is made from only one type of monomer unit. In the repeating structural unit of a homopolymer, only one type of monomer unit is present.On the other hand, copolymer is made from two (or more) types of monomer units. In the repeating structural unit of a copolymer, two (or more) types of monomer unit are present.
Polythene, Teflon, PAN and nylon-6 are some examples of homopolymers. Thus, polythene is made from only one type of monomer unit which is ethylene.Buna-S, Buna-N, polyester, Bakelite and nylon-6,6 are some examples of copolymers. Thus, buna-S is made from two types of monomer units which are styrene and 1,3-butadiene.
